Q: Is 3,668,538 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 3,668,538 is not a prime number.

Why is 3,668,538 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 3668538 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 47 94 141 282 13,009 26,018 39,027 78,054 611,423 1,222,846 1,834,269 and 3,668,538, with no remainder.

Since 3,668,538 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,668,538, it is not a prime number.
